Great for Training and Skill Development

Use Cases and Deployment Scope

We use Go1 for new employee onboarding, for training and for helping employees develop their skills. It allows us to have all our training courses in one place, assign courses to employees and keep track of when they have completed them. It cuts down on the amount of manual work and frees up time for our team. In short, Go1 makes it simpler and more organized to manage employee learning and training.

Go1 - Excellent LMS for SMEs

Use Cases and Deployment Scope

Being a small company, the budget for development is restricted. Previously we focussed purely on mandatory compliance training only (health & safety, GDPR etc), sourcing each course as it was required. This was a very reactive approach, which was hard to manage and not very cost effective. We researched multiple LMS solutions to provide our staff with a more proactive approach to learning, and Go1 presented the best model by far! For the same average cost per employee of those ad hoc mandatory courses over the year, we could offer them with over 70,000 options for compliance professional and personal learning.
Because of the previous lack of development, we launched the content in phases. To start we launched a host of compliance courses (including a few of our own courses) and initiated an annual compliance learning cycle. As staff got used to the new approach to learning, we expanded to include selected professional development courses based on manager and employee requests - Excel skills, Tackling Difficult Conversations etc. With the fantastic adoption of learning across the company, we have now released the full suite of 70,000+ courses with a push for self-managed learning.
